Harnessing the Power of Tomorrow: The Rise of Energy Storage

As we navigate the complexities of a rapidly changing world, one thing is becoming increasingly clear: our reliance on fossil fuels is no longer sustainable. The imperative to transition to renewable energy sources is pressing, and the technology to make it happen is rapidly evolving. At the heart of this revolution is energy storage – the unsung hero that’s about to transform the way we think about power.

Energy storage refers to the ability to store excess energy generated by renewable sources like solar and wind power, making it available when it’s needed most. For too long, the intermittency of these sources has been the primary obstacle to widespread adoption. But with advancements in battery technology, energy storage is no longer just a nicety – it’s a necessity.

One of the most exciting developments in the field is the proliferation of lithium-ion batteries. These batteries have improved dramatically in recent years, offering greater energy density, longer lifetimes, and lower costs. Companies like Tesla and sonnen are already using lithium-ion batteries to create innovative energy storage solutions, from home battery systems to grid-scale energy storage facilities.

But lithium-ion batteries are just the beginning. Other technologies, like flow batteries and hydrogen storage, are also vying for attention. Flow batteries, for instance, use liquid electrolytes to store energy, offering high capacity and long lifetimes. Hydrogen storage, meanwhile, involves converting excess energy into hydrogen gas, which can be stored and used to generate electricity when needed.

The potential impact of energy storage is vast. By storing excess energy during periods of low demand, utilities can reduce their reliance on peaking power plants, which are often powered by fossil fuels. This not only decreases greenhouse gas emissions but also provides a more stable and resilient grid. Imagine a world where energy is no longer a scarce resource, but a readily available one, waiting to be tapped when it’s needed.

The economic benefits of energy storage are equally compelling. As the cost of batteries continues to decline, the payback period for energy storage installations is shrinking. This means that businesses and homeowners can now justify the investment in energy storage, knowing that it will pay for itself in the long run.

Of course, there are still challenges to be addressed. The grid infrastructure is not yet equipped to handle the variability of renewable energy sources, and energy storage solutions are still relatively expensive. But these are problems that can be solved with time, investment, and innovation.
